WebOct 21, 2024 · Ventricular septal defect (VSD) occurs as the baby's heart is developing during pregnancy. The muscular wall separating the heart into left and right sides doesn't form fully, leaving one or more holes. The size of the hole or holes can vary. There's often no clear cause. Genetics and environmental factors may play a role. WebIrregular Heart Rate — Symptoms Older children complain of chest pain, a fluttering feeling in the chest, or lightheadedness.
